Brasilia (BSB) to Patras (GPA)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Presidente Juscelino Kubistschek International Airport (BSB) in Brasilia, Brazil to Araxos Airport (GPA) in Patras, Greece is 9,383 kilometers (5,830 miles / 5,067 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 12h, flying northeast at a heading of 48°.

This is an ultra-long-haul route, one of the longest in aviation. It requires wide-body aircraft with extended range capability such as the Airbus A350-900ULR or Boeing 777-200LR. Passengers should prepare for an extended flight with multiple meal services.

This is an international route connecting Brazil with Greece. It is an intercontinental flight between South America and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 08:15 in Brasilia, it's 14:15 in Patras. With a 6-hour time difference, travelers should plan for significant jet lag. It typically takes one day per hour of time difference to fully adjust.

There is a significant elevation difference of 3,451 feet between the two airports. Araxos Airport sits lower than Presidente Juscelino Kubistschek International Airport.

The return flight from Patras (GPA) to Brasilia (BSB) follows a heading of 245° (west south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
